Samsung introduces One UI 8.5 beta program; promotes Next-Level Ease of Use

Samsung has launched the One UI 8.5 beta program, which focuses on simplifying user interactions with enhanced features for seamless actions, device management, and improved security.

One UI 8.5: What’s New for Content Creation? 

One UI 8.5 makes it easier to create and share content from start to finish. Users can keep making new images without stopping, thanks to the updated Photo Assist. They can edit photos continuously without saving each version. When they’re done, they can review all their work in the edit history and choose their favorites.

Sharing is also easier with improvements to Quick Share, which now recognizes people in photos and suggests sending them directly to those contacts.

How Does One UI 8.5 Improve Device Connectivity?

New cross-device features simplify managing devices, whether for file sharing, network access, or communication with nearby devices. Audio Broadcast allows easy interaction with LE Audio-supported devices using Auracast. Users can now also broadcast their voice through their Galaxy phone’s microphone, which is great for groups during tours or events.

Storage Share enhances the Galaxy ecosystem by displaying files from other Galaxy devices, like tablets and PCs, in the My Files app. It also lets users access their phone’s files from other Samsung devices, including TVs.

How Is My Galaxy Device Staying Protected?

One UI 8.5 improves device security and gives users better control over their settings. Theft Protection secures phones and data if lost or stolen. Additionally, Failed Authentication Lock locks the screen after too many failed fingerprint, PIN, or password attempts. Identity check also protects more settings than before, adding extra security.

Availability

The One UI 8.5 beta program will start for Galaxy S25 users in select markets like Germany, India, Korea, Poland, the UK, and the U.S. on December 8, 2025. Users can join the beta program through the Samsung Members app.
